Manufacturers get peek at World Class Precision Products

Arrowhead Manufacturers & Fabricators Association meets Nov. 7 in Bayfield, Wis., at World Class Precision Products.

Participants will hear from Bob Peltonen, owner of World Class Precision Products, on the topic “Workforce and Economic Development.” Peltonen presents information about the northern Wisconsin workforce and economic development in Bayfield County and the surrounding area.

Following the lunch meeting, the group tours World Class Precision Products. World Class produces machined parts and assemblies to their customer’s specifications with high precision needs such as .0004 tolerances and automotive cosmetics.

The meeting is open to current and prospective members. Register for the luncheon by contacting LeeAnn Rostberg at 877-330-2632 or leeannr@runestone.net.

Arrowhead Manufacturers & Fabricators Association is an 86-member organization serving manufacturers and related industries in northeastern Minnesota and northwestern Wisconsin.
